Kimi and Jordan are each working during the summer to earn money in addition to their
weekly allowance, and they are saving all of their
money. Kimi earns $9 per hour at her job, and
her allowance is $8 each week. Jordan earns
$7 per hour, and his allowance is $16 each week.
Complete the tables shown below to represent
Kimi and Jordan's savings based on the hours they
work each week.
